Your A-List: Best Band with six members or more
The ’60s sound of Hwy 90, from San Antonio to New Orleans, is still very much alive according to A-list voters who’ve chosen Larry Lange and His Lonely Knights as the best Austin band with six or more members. Prince’s favorite Austin band Grupo Fantasma came in second. A longtime bassist for Delbert McClinton and others, Lange made a move on the horn-laden Gulf Coast soul concept about three years ago and he and the Knights have had folks slowdancing and juking to Sunny and the Sunliners, Cookie and the Cupcakes and the like ever since.
